Transaction 996276438414bffba61fbad0a5159b49f4f4841a8b4da29b6f5d033bcd704913

1 Input
2 Outputs
  • 996276438414bffba61fbad0a5159b49f4f4841a8b4da29b6f5d033bcd704913:0
  • value  1083601
    address  2N6sFiDcQkq4vLAGx7eNH55MgNnGZzuyBeg
  • 996276438414bffba61fbad0a5159b49f4f4841a8b4da29b6f5d033bcd704913:1
  • value  100000
    address  2N3fDWemArQrLGyhLXv4kYP7ojNsYmSj6dX